Applying the Bulk Modulus formula to compress mercury by 1% \u2026 I learned it would take 35,594 psi! Compare that to the 14.7psi in our atmosphere. Specific weight and specific gravity were new concepts, and both were a little less challenging after working through a couple problems. Based on the levels of fluids in a manometer I calculated pressure at a specific point. Conversions between inches of mercury and pressure units seemed simple but I was fortunate to catch my mistake by looking at my answer (problem 3.90) and understanding the answer was not reasonable. I also calculated forces due to gas pressure, forces on a horizontal surface under the pressure of a liquid.
